The International Livestock Research Institute (ILRI) seeks to recruit a Head of Administration & Director General’s Deputy Representative, for Ethiopia, to oversee the day-to-day management of all administrative services that support ILRI’s activities and operations in Ethiopia and to deputize the Director General’s Representative to Ethiopia.

ILRI works to improve food security and nutrition, and reduce poverty in developing countries through research for efficient, safe and sustainable use of livestock. It is the only one of 11 CGIAR research centres dedicated entirely to animal agriculture research for the developing world. Co-hosted by Kenya and Ethiopia, ILRI has regional or country offices and projects in East, South and Southeast Asia as well as Central, East, Southern and West Africa. www.ilri.org
